Confessing Jesus before men…

I find it interesting this verse comes up next after some recent events in my life. Confessing Jesus before men doesn’t always look like what you see in the picture, but it can be. Either way, God is good and Jesus is more than worthy.

32 So everyone who acknowledges me before men, I also will acknowledge before my Father who is in heaven, 33 but whoever denies me before men, I also will deny before my Father who is in heaven. Matthew 10:32-33 ESV

32 Whosoever therefore shall confess me before men, him will I confess also before my Father which is in heaven. 33 But whosoever shall deny me before men, him will I also deny before my Father which is in heaven. Matthew 10:32-33 KJV

ὁμολογήσει / homologēsei = will confess

I believe KJV has a better translation for this verse. Biblehub provides an easy way to see the words translated word by word. You can also click the number designation for each word, for a definition.

Truth: If you’ve confessed Jesus before people, Jesus will confess you before the Father. Think about that, If you’ve confessed Jesus, Jesus has or will speak your name to the Father. He talks about you. But if you deny him, yes, he will deny you.

I was recently reminded of the stage Jesus took on for you and me. Clothed in purple, bleeding everywhere, with a crown of thorns on his head. Everyone screamed, “crucify him”. He was then pulled from that stage and taken to a hill not far away. Another stage if you will, with a splintery ole cross where they would nail him to it and lift him up to be on display, tortured and at the same time accused and taunted by people. And he was willing to take on that stage for you and for me.
